Rebecca - 31-Days of Awareness and Giving
When I was 6 years old, I was diagnosed with Dandy-Walker Syndrome. My CT showed a very large cyst pushing on my cerebellum, and it took going to four neurosurgeons before one agreed to operate on me, saying it was very dangerous.
I decided I wanted to be a nurse after my third neurosurgery when I was 11 years old. I wanted to make other people feel the way the nurses made me feel. I told my high school guidance counsellor that, and she told me to go for something easier, because she didn’t want to see me fail. I didn’t listen to her, and I’m glad I didn’t.
I am now 34 years old. I have survived through 16 neurosurgeries. I have been a nurse for 14 years. I have beaten the odds and accomplished more than many thought was possible with my diagnosis. I want to thank my family for always believing in me.
